摘要
A new technique for measuring a thermal lens, using a holographic shearing interferometer is presented. This technique was used to measure transient thermal lensing in a laser diode pumped NYAB laser. The measured thermal lensing power was proportional to the pumping laser diode intensity, with a gradient of 1.1 x 10(-1) m-l mm(2)/W. The transient response time of the thermal lens was 1.5 s, this value being consistent with the temporal decline of the second harmonic power. (C) 1997 Elsevier Science B.V.
